Ensured consistency with AI agents
Pythian created a Copilot knowledge agent trained exclusively on approved corporate policies. This agent provides sourced, highly consistent answers to client questionnaires, eliminating the manual search through hundreds of historical documents.
Accelerated risk analysis
We designed an agent to analyze vendor documentation against "Gold Standard" criteria. This solution automatically generates a risk heat map and follow-up emails, reducing a multi-day manual review process to a fraction of the time.
Streamlined document creation
Pythian developed a systematic workflow for an NDA Drafting Agent. By using existing templates and programmatically collecting variables, the team can now generate new contracts with significantly less administrative effort.
Mitigated hallucination risks
Pythian refined initial agent prompts to ensure strict reliance on specified internal sources. This training empowered the corporate risk management teams to get more value out of Copilot while maintaining high accuracy.
